Day 3 - Mürren

We travel by train to the picturesque mountain village of Mürren today. Situated high above the Lauterbrunnen Valley at 5,413 ft (1,650 m) above sea level, the village is a popular tourist destination all year round, thanks to the incredible mountain views it offers - and in winter in particular, it is alive with activity. Your time in this traffic-free village is free for you to explore at your own pace. Perhaps take a walk on one of the well-prepared footpaths and admire the spectacular scenery, or even have a go at skating on the open-air ice rink if you're feeling adventurous. Another popular option is the Schilthorn (payable locally). From Mürren, you can take a cable car to the summit - where you can visit the Piz Gloria, which was the world's first revolving restaurant and was made famous in the James Bond film, 'On Her Majesty's Secret Service'. We return to Interlaken in time dinner. (B,D)


Day 4 - A day at leisure

Your day is free, giving you the opportunity to use your GRJ Swiss Travel Card for 50% fares to explore further afield. From our base in Interlaken there are many mountain peaks and beautiful places to be discovered - why not make the journey across the Brünig Pass to Lucerne, a favourite destination among Great Rail Journeys customers due to its wonderful lakeside location and stunning mountain scenery. The compact city boasts charming streets and the famous 14th century Chapel Bridge, which was built in 1333 and is the oldest wooden bridge in Europe. Other highlights include the nearby water tower, which has served as a prison and a treasury in its long history. The Swiss Transport Museum, with its fascinating collection of artefacts on land, air and sea transportation, is also a popular option. Alternatively, you could visit Montreux, which is easily accessible by rail and superbly situated on the shores of Lake Geneva. From here you can take a fabulous journey into the mountains by cog railway to Rochers de Naye, one of Switzerland's most beautiful viewpoints. You could then return to Interlaken along the beautiful GoldenPass panoramic line, taking in the magnificent scenery along the route. (B)

Day 6 - New Year's Day on the Jungfrau Railway

On New Year's Day we enjoy what is undoubtedly the highlight of our stay in the Bernese Oberland, with our excursion to the summit of the Jungfrau. We begin on the Bernese Oberland Railway trundling through the foothills of the Alps from Interlaken to Lauterbrunnen, through snowy pastures and past pretty villages. In Lauterbrunnen, we change trains to continue our ascent through ever changing scenery, to reach Kleine Scheidegg, where we join the Jungfrau Railway itself. Rising higher still, from Kleine Scheidegg the distinctive string of red and yellow carriages disappear into the tunnel through the Eiger mountain, making stops at the observation windows hewn out of solid Alpine rock, before emerging at Jungfraujoch, the 'Top of Europe', located at 3545m above sea level. With free time at the summit station, you will have plenty of time to explore the Ice Palace and its many ice sculptures, the Sphinx Terrace with superb views onto the Aletsch Glacier, at 22 km the longest ice stream in the Alps, and the walking plateau, eternally covered in snow. After time to explore and to enjoy lunch, we descend via the charming mountain resort of Grindelwald. (B,D)
